What to Consider for Custom Electrical Enclosure Design?
- Structure & Size:Determine size based on installation site, allowing room for operation/maintenance. Use robust materials like cold-rolled steel (1.2-2.0mm) or stainless steel.
- Electrical Performance:Select the appropriate enclosure specifications based on the voltage, current, frequency, and other parameters of the connected equipment.
- Environmental Adaptability:Select the appropriate IP rating based on the installation environment, such as IP54 (dust and water protected) or IP66 (dust-tight and protected against powerful water jets). In chemically corrosive environments, use stainless steel materials or surface zinc plating to extend the enclosure’s service life.
- Heat Dissipation and Ventilation:Incorporate ventilation holes or slots in appropriate areas of the enclosure to prevent excessive internal temperatures.
- Mechanical Structure and Handling:Choose suitable door type (front/side/rear) for easy maintenance. Include lifting hooks for portability. Eliminate sharp edges for operator protection.
